Governor Pat Quinn Signs Bill to Make Board of Review Appeals Easier for Cook County Property Owners
By Communications Staff at September 6, 2012 | 9:44 am | 0 Comment
On August 23rd, Illinois Governor Pat Quinn signed Senate Bill 3386 allowing the Cook County Board of Review to modernize operations and making it easier and more convenient for property owners to file appeals of the assessed values of their homes and businesses. Governor Quinn Signs Bill Increasing Participation of Minority and Woman-owned Businesses in FPDCC Contracts
By Sebastian James at July 18, 2012 | 3:25 pm | 0 Comment
Governor Pat Quinn today signed a new law today allowing the Forest Preserve District of Cook County to establish provisions to address the underuse of minority and women-owned businesses (MBE/WBE) with respect to construction and procurement contracts.
